Online gaming has become a cornerstone of modern entertainment, offering players vast digital landscapes to explore, conquer, and connect. From competitive multiplayer battles to expansive narrative-driven adventures, these virtual worlds provide diverse challenges that engage both casual players and dedicated enthusiasts. Each game offers a distinct universe where strategy, creativity, and quick thinking determine success, creating experiences that are both thrilling and immersive.
Accessibility has fueled the widespread popularity of online games. With just a device and an internet connection, players can join global communities, participate in tournaments, and collaborate with friends from anywhere. Cross-platform functionality allows seamless gameplay across mobile devices, PCs, and consoles, making it easy to stay connected and continue progress across multiple devices. Social features encourage teamwork and cooperation, while competitive modes test individual skill and strategy.
Dynamic content keeps players invested in the experience. Games frequently receive updates, seasonal events, and expansions that introduce new challenges, environments, and storylines. Battle arenas rotate objectives, role-playing games add characters and quests, and casual titles provide fresh mechanics or puzzles. These evolving elements ensure that each gaming session offers something new, keeping players engaged over long periods.
Progression systems enhance motivation and achievement. Players unlock levels, collect rare items, and achieve milestones, creating measurable goals that reward skill and persistence. Leaderboards provide recognition for top performers, fostering healthy competition. The satisfaction of progressing, mastering abilities, and acquiring unique rewards deepens engagement and encourages long-term commitment to the game.
Social interaction is at the heart of online gaming. Cooperative missions, team challenges, and guilds encourage communication, coordination, and strategic thinking. Voice and text chat systems allow players to coordinate effectively, form alliances, and build rivalries. These interactions often extend beyond gameplay, creating online communities and friendships that enrich the overall experience.
Technological advancements have elevated the quality 888b of digital worlds. High-definition graphics, sophisticated AI, and realistic physics enhance immersion. Vir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R) technologies further deepen engagement, allowing players to step inside their virtual worlds. Mobile platforms now host complex, console-quality games, making immersive experiences accessible to a wider audience than ever before.
Monetization methods have also shaped online gaming. Free-to-play models, subscriptions, and in-game purchases allow developers to fund content while giving players options in how they engage. Cosmetic items, character customization, and expansion packs provide personalization without altering core gameplay balance. Although discussions about fairness persist, these models increase accessibility and enable innovative gameplay experiences.
Online gaming has evolved into a cultural phenomenon. E-sports competitions, streaming platforms, and content creation allow skilled players to reach global audiences and build careers. With ever-changing challenges, immersive storytelling, and collaborative gameplay, online games offer endless opportunities for adventure, strategy, and social connection, captivating millions of players worldwide.
